Salifert Magnesium test expiration date
I have a test that is more than half full but the box is showing an expiration date of 5/2013...what happens if i keep using it after May?.I assume the test results may become unreliable?..what expires actually?...there are 3 different solutions being added...i just hate throwing it away when there so much left.
Anyone ever used any of theses tests kits past the expiration date? |

If the colorchange is sharp then just use it.
However, just be sure you had the caps tightened properly after each use, in particular of the Mg-3. Otherwise it could, because of evaporation, give a lower result than actual.
